English

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

From Inuktitut ᓄᓇᕗᒻᒥᐅᖅ (nonafommioq).

Noun

[edit]

Nunavummiuq (plural Nunavummiut)

  1. A person from Nunavut.

French

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

Borrowed from Inuktitut ᓄᓇᕗᒻᒥᐅᖅ (nonafommioq).

Noun

[edit]

Nunavummiuq m or f by sense (plural Nunavummiut)

  1. resident or native of Nunavut

Hyponyms

[edit]
  • Nunavutien (a male resident or native of Nunavut)
  • Nunavutienne (a female resident or native of Nunavut)
  • Nunavutois (a male resident or native of Nunavut)
  • Nunavutoise (a female resident or native of Nunavut)
  • Nunavois (a male resident or native of Nunavut)
  • Nunavoise (a female resident or native of Nunavut)
